JOB SUMMARY The role of the Quality Control Manager is to provide oversight, daily administrative management, and direct supervision of the Quality control department.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ES Include the following. Others may be assigned.

  • Manages the claims quality auditors and daily activities of quality claims audit function. Reviews and tracks claims quality audit reports and measures performance of auditors. Provides assistance in developing claims audit policies and procedures. May provide coaching in complex claims audit. Manages subordinate staff in the day-to-day performance of their jobs. Ensures that project/department milestones/goals are met. Has full authority for personnel actions. Extensive knowledge of department processes.
  • Responsible for insuring client deliverables are met related to the quality/compliance standards per current contract terms or SLAs. This may be accomplished by, but not limited to the following:
    • Coordinating daily workflow of auditing team to insure timely auditing of staff accounts
    • Distributing workload amongst auditors by allocating assignments according to client needs
    • Directing work priorities of direct reports and/or support staff to insure timely processing of claims and or project deadlines.
    • Provides input to strategic decisions that affect the functional area of responsibility such as
    • Claims department, Compliance and Quality Control department.
    • Develops a QC Plan that includes methods to measure, track, analyze, report performance trends, root cause analysis of deficiencies, implement corrective actions, and provide follow up.
    • Proactively identify opportunities for improvement to processes and scripts, responsible for reporting and documenting problems, concerns or any issues identified during the review process to Operations Excellence Committee and/or other Committees.
    • Audits system configuration for new client implementation and provider or Health Plan contracts and amendments.
    • Various administrative functions associated with the above duties include but are not limited to budget development and monitoring, performance evaluations, team meetings and huddles, interviewing/hiring new applicants, action plan development, corrective action, scheduling, coordinating internal and external quality reviews.       • Strong knowledge and understanding of Managed Healthcare.
      • Excellent communication skills, written and verbal.
      • Must be well versed in reading Health Plan DOFRs and understand all types of fee schedules, including risk pools.
      • Excellent knowledge of CPT, RBRVS, DRG, HCPCS and ICD-9 coding and regulations.
      • Software: Microsoft Office, EZ-Cap, McKesson Claim Check, Redbook, DRG Pricing Software
      • Skilled in performing quality assessment/analysis
      • Skilled in formulating or writing scripts
      • Ability to apply common sense understanding to carry out instructions furnished in written, oral or diagram form. Ability to deal with problems involving several concrete variables in standardized situations.
      • Must have strong interpersonal, written and verbal communication skills and management experience.
      • Ability to think/work independently yet interconnect with the team.
      • Advance problem-solving skills
